Windows 下 OpenVPN 的完整安装与配置指南

hyde1011 2026-01-15 VPN加速器 2 0

在当今远程办公和跨地域网络连接日益普及的背景下,虚拟私人网络(VPN)已成为保障数据安全、实现内网访问的重要工具,OpenVPN 是一款开源、功能强大且广泛使用的 VPN 解决方案,支持多种操作系统,包括 Windows,本文将详细介绍如何在 Windows 系统上安装并配置 OpenVPN 客户端,帮助用户快速建立安全可靠的远程连接。

准备工作
在开始安装之前,请确保你已准备好以下内容:

  1. 一台运行 Windows 10 或更高版本的电脑(推荐使用 64 位系统);
  2. OpenVPN 安装包(官方下载地址为 https://openvpn.net/community-downloads/);
  3. 一个有效的 OpenVPN 配置文件(通常以 .ovpn ,由你的网络管理员或服务提供商提供;
  4. 互联网连接,用于下载和验证配置。

安装 OpenVPN 客户端
第一步:下载并运行安装程序
前往 OpenVPN 官方网站,选择适用于 Windows 的最新稳定版安装包(如 openvpn-install-2.5.8-I601-x86_64.exe),点击下载后,双击运行安装文件,安装过程中会提示是否允许更改系统设置,建议勾选“Install OpenVPN Service”选项,以便后台自动启动服务。

第二步:配置防火墙规则
安装完成后,Windows 防火墙可能会阻止 OpenVPN 的通信,此时需要手动添加例外规则:

  • 打开“控制面板 > Windows Defender 防火墙 > 允许应用通过防火墙”;
  • 点击“更改设置”,找到“OpenVPN Service”并勾选“专用网络”和“公用网络”。
    若未发现该服务,可点击“允许其他应用”并浏览至 C:\Program Files\OpenVPN\bin\openvpnserv.exe 添加。

导入并配置连接
第三步:将 .ovpn 文件导入客户端
将收到的 .ovpn 配置文件复制到本地磁盘(如 C:\Users\YourName\Documents\OpenVPN\Configs)。
打开 OpenVPN GUI(可通过开始菜单搜索“OpenVPN”启动),右键点击任务栏图标,选择“Import file...”,导航至 .ovpn 文件所在目录,选择并导入。

第四步:连接测试
导入成功后,在 OpenVPN GUI 中右键点击刚刚导入的配置文件,选择“Connect”,如果一切正常,任务栏图标会显示绿色状态,并在日志中出现类似“Initialization Sequence Completed”的提示,表示连接已建立。

常见问题排查
若连接失败,请按以下步骤检查:

  • 检查 .ovpn 文件是否正确(如服务器地址、端口、认证方式等);
  • 确认用户名和密码(或证书)是否输入无误;
  • 查看 Windows 事件查看器中的 OpenVPN 服务日志(路径:事件查看器 > Windows 日志 > 应用程序);
  • 若使用公司网络,可能需联系 IT 部门确认是否允许 UDP/TCP 443 端口通行。

进阶配置建议
为提升安全性,建议:

  • 使用证书认证而非密码(更安全);
  • 设置自动连接(在 .ovpn 文件中添加 auth-user-passpersist-key 参数);
  • 启用“TAP-Windows Adapter”驱动(默认已安装,但可更新至最新版本);
  • 使用脚本自动处理断线重连(如添加 reneg-sec 0 参数)。


通过以上步骤,Windows 用户可以轻松完成 OpenVPN 客户端的安装与基础配置,实现安全稳定的远程接入,无论是企业员工还是个人用户,掌握这一技能都极具实用价值,随着网络安全意识的增强,合理使用 OpenVPN 将成为数字时代不可或缺的能力之一。

Windows 下 OpenVPN 的完整安装与配置指南

半仙加速器